The crystal structures of [NH3F](+)[CF3SO3](-), [NH2F2](+)[SbF6](-), and [N2F3](+)[Sb3F16](-) have been determined, representing the first structural characterizations of these simple fluoro-nitrogen cations. The influences of the hybridization of the central nitrogen atom and of the number of fluorine substituents on the N-F bond lengths are evaluated for the series N2F+, N2F3+, NF2O+, NH3F+, NH2F2+, and NF4+. It is shown that the N-F bond length decreases from 1.40 angstrom to 1.26 angstrom with increasing fluorine substitution and increasing s-character of the nitrogen atom, and that unusual N-F bond lengths reported in the previous literature are caused by disorder problems
